Output b4e0c2a31649a221dde6d77192d684338fc76661f84f0aea6db7c766e1ee34e0:3

value
342678489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0da5d68616e6742583e9d0ed6606cac407374f8f OP_EQUAL
address
32wBNfPQpU5BEWj9bxFWUiDDiGYHtFhENM
transaction
b4e0c2a31649a221dde6d77192d684338fc76661f84f0aea6db7c766e1ee34e0
spent
true